mysql

mysql score如何实现分页查询

小樊
82
2024-09-06 15:19:01
栏目: 云计算

在MySQL中,要实现分页查询,可以使用LIMITOFFSET关键字。假设你有一个名为score的表,你想要对其进行分页查询。

首先,确定每页显示的记录数(例如:每页显示10条记录)。然后,根据需要显示的页码计算OFFSET值。

OFFSET值的计算公式为:OFFSET = (页码 - 1) * 每页显示的记录数

举个例子,如果你想要查询第2页的数据,每页显示10条记录,那么OFFSET值为:

OFFSET = (2 - 1) * 10 = 10

最后,编写SQL查询语句,使用LIMITOFFSET关键字进行分页查询。例如:

SELECT * FROM score
ORDER BY some_column
LIMIT 10 OFFSET 10;

这将会返回第2页的数据,每页10条记录。注意,你需要根据实际情况替换some_column为你需要排序的列名。

0
看了该问题的人还看了